Understanding Canva's Measuring Tool

When it comes to design, precision is key. Whether you're working on a print project or designing graphics for the web, having accurate measurements can make all the difference. While Canva offers a plethora of design features, it does not have a dedicated measuring tool like those found in professional design software.

But fear not! While there isn't an explicit measuring tool in Canva, there are several workarounds that can help you achieve precise measurements while designing your projects.

Using Grids and Guides

An effective way to ensure accurate measurements in Canva is by utilizing grids and guides. These features help you align elements precisely and maintain consistent spacing throughout your design.

To access grids and guides in Canva:

  • Click on the "Elements" tab on the left-hand sidebar.
  • Select "Grids" or "Guides" from the options available.
  • You can choose from pre-designed grids or create custom ones according to your requirements.

By enabling grids or guides, you can easily align objects, text, and images with precision. This method ensures that every element is measured accurately without the need for a dedicated measuring tool.

Utilizing Keyboard Shortcuts

In addition to using grids and guides, another way to achieve precise measurements in Canva is by utilizing keyboard shortcuts. These shortcuts allow you to resize, move, and align elements with precision.

Here are some essential keyboard shortcuts that can come in handy:

  • Shift + Arrow keys: Move elements in small increments for precise positioning.
  • Shift + Drag: Maintain aspect ratio while resizing elements.
  • Alt + Drag: Duplicate elements quickly.

By incorporating these keyboard shortcuts into your design workflow, you can ensure accurate measurements without the need for a dedicated measuring tool.

The Importance of Precise Measurements

Precise measurements are crucial in design as they contribute to the overall aesthetics and professionalism of your project. Whether you're creating a social media graphic, a flyer, or a business card, accurate measurements help maintain consistency and harmony within your design.

Furthermore, precise measurements are essential when it comes to printing your designs. Improperly sized graphics can result in distorted images or text that may not fit within the intended space. By paying attention to measurements during the design process, you can avoid such issues and ensure high-quality prints.
